London-Gatwick Airport South Terminal evacuated

As a precaution for safety reasons

Brief. The management company of London-Gatwick airport informs in a post on X that "A large part of the South Terminal has been evacuated as a precaution while we continue to investigate a security incident.

During the works, passengers will not be able to access the South Terminal. The safety of passengers and staff remains our top priority. We are working intensively to resolve the issue as quickly as possible".
